Yeshua bar-Yosef has been crucified, accused of plotting to overthrow the government of Pontius Pilate. His family and friends have gathered in the house of Amos the Cloth merchant to celebrate the Jewish Passover but instead of relating the Jewish narrative of salvation, they reminisce about Yeshua, the boy he was and the man he became. Told in the voices of those who knew him, loved him and even hated him, this is the story of the man who would become known to the world as Jesus Christ.

This imaginative retelling of the three days between the crucifixion and the resurrection is based on recent research into the historical Jesus and on the work of archaeologists and historians in Israel and Palestine.
